Which Are the Best Luxury Hotels in Abu Dhabi for 2026?
Emirates Palace Mandarin Oriental
Located along the Corniche, Emirates Palace Mandarin Oriental remains the benchmark for luxury hospitality in Abu Dhabi. Its palatial architecture, private beach, world class dining, and legendary service continue attracting royalty, executives, and UHNW travelers.
Best for:
- Ultra luxury travelers
- VIP guests
- Luxury families
- High profile visitors
The St. Regis Saadiyat Island Resort
Among the finest Saadiyat Island resorts, The St. Regis offers elegant beachfront luxury combined with direct access to one of the UAE’s most beautiful coastlines.
Best for:
- Couples
- Golf enthusiasts
- Beach lovers
- Luxury vacationers
Park Hyatt Abu Dhabi Hotel and Villas
Park Hyatt combines understated sophistication with exceptional privacy. Moreover, its spacious villas and tranquil beachfront setting appeal strongly to affluent travelers.
Best for:
- Couples
- Wellness travelers
- Long stay guests
- Privacy seekers
Jumeirah at Saadiyat Island Resort
This contemporary resort emphasizes sustainability, wellness, and beachfront luxury. Consequently, it attracts travelers seeking refined experiences connected to nature.
Best for:
- Wellness travelers
- Couples
- Eco conscious luxury guests
- Relaxation focused visitors
The Edition Abu Dhabi
Located in Al Bateen Marina, The Edition delivers boutique luxury with contemporary design and personalized service.
Best for:
- Design enthusiasts
- Executives
- Urban luxury travelers
- Couples
Shangri-La Qaryat Al Beri
Offering stunning views of Sheikh Zayed Grand Mosque, Shangri La combines traditional Arabian elegance with modern luxury.
Best for:
- Families
- Cultural travelers
- Luxury vacationers
- Couples
W Abu Dhabi Yas Island
As one of the most recognizable hotels in the UAE, W Abu Dhabi sits directly above the Yas Marina Circuit. Consequently, it delivers unmatched access to Yas Island luxury experiences.
Best for:
- Motorsport fans
- Younger luxury travelers
- Entertainment seekers
- Social travelers
Anantara Eastern Mangroves
This property offers a unique luxury experience overlooking Abu Dhabi’s protected mangrove ecosystem.
Best for:
- Wellness travelers
- Nature lovers
- Executives
- Couples

What Role Do Saadiyat and Yas Island Play in Luxury Travel?
Saadiyat Island and Yas Island form the foundation of Abu Dhabi’s luxury tourism ecosystem. However, each serves a distinct audience and travel style.
Saadiyat Island functions as the cultural and beachfront luxury hub. Home to luxury resorts, pristine beaches, and institutions such as Louvre Abu Dhabi, it attracts sophisticated travelers seeking serenity and refinement.
Meanwhile, Yas Island serves as the entertainment center of luxury tourism.
Highlights include:
- Yas Marina Circuit
- Ferrari World
- Warner Bros. World
- Yas Bay Waterfront
- Luxury lifestyle experiences
Consequently, many visitors combine both islands within a single luxury itinerary.
When Is the Best Time to Visit Abu Dhabi for Luxury Travel?
The ideal luxury travel season runs from October through April when temperatures remain pleasant and outdoor activities are most enjoyable.
Moreover, several major international events occur during this period, attracting affluent visitors from around the world.
Recommended travel windows:
- October to November for ideal weather
- December to February for peak luxury season
- March to April for balanced conditions
- November for Formula One events
- Winter months for beach vacations
Nevertheless, summer offers attractive pricing and greater exclusivity for travelers comfortable with warmer temperatures.
